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Virginia Water to Carnoustie start from as little as £61.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Virginia Water to Carnoustie start from £108.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Virginia Water to Carnoustie are available for £226.50 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Services

Virginia Water train station is well-equipped to cater to the needs of its passengers.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 18:00 on weekdays, 08:00 to 17:00 on Saturdays, and 09:00 to 15:00 on Sundays. For those purchasing tickets online, there's a convenient ticket machine available for collection. The station is also prepared to assist passengers with disabilities, offering accessible ticket machines that acc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

Travelers staying at the station can take advantage of facilities such as waiting rooms with heated seating in the booking hall, step-free access to all platforms, and accessible toilets located on Platform 1. However, do note that there are no staffed help services on site, so plan accordingly.

Facilities and Amenities

Carnoustie train station is equipped with essential amenities designed to facilitate a smooth and hassle-free travel experience. While there isn't a dedicated ticket office,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. However, tickets bought online cannot be collected here, so plan accordingly. The station also features smartcard validators, making it convenient for regular travelers.

Seeking help? While there may not be staff assistance directly at Carnoustie, customer help points are strategically located throughout the station. For any queries, the help point staff are ready to assist. Safety and security are taken seriously with CCTV surveillance ensuring a secure environment for all passengers.

If accessibility is key to your travel, you'll appreciate Carnoustie's infrastructure. The station provides partial step-free access with ramps available to both platforms. Although there's no dedicated waiting room, seating areas are available, ensuring a bit of comfort as you wait for your train.

Onward Travel Options

Once you arrive in Carnoustie, getting to your next destination is simple. Buses serve as the primary mode of onward travel, picking up and dropping off passengers on the Main road (A930). For specific bus routes and schedules, drop by Traveline Scotland or call 0871 200 22 33 for round-the-clock assistance.

If you prefer a more direct route, taxis are available via Train Taxi. Such connections ensure you're never too far from local attractions or the next leg of your journey.
